How stable is Nosiheptide at different temperatures?

First off, let's talk a bit about nosiheptide. It's a really cool antibiotic that's widely used in animal feed. It helps improve the growth rate of livestock and poultry, and also boosts their feed efficiency. It's safe, effective, and has a low risk of resistance development, which is why it's such a popular choice in the animal husbandry industry.

Now, onto the main question: how stable is nosiheptide at different temperatures? Well, like most chemical compounds, nosiheptide's stability is influenced by temperature. In general, higher temperatures can speed up chemical reactions, which might lead to the degradation of nosiheptide over time.

Let's start with lower temperatures. When stored at low temperatures, say around 4°C, nosiheptide is quite stable. The low temperature slows down the molecular movement and chemical reactions, which means the nosiheptide molecules are less likely to break down. This is a great option if you're planning to store nosiheptide for a long time. You can think of it like putting food in the fridge to keep it fresh. At this temperature, you can expect nosiheptide to maintain its quality and effectiveness for an extended period.

But what about room temperature? Room temperature is usually around 20 - 25°C. At this range, nosiheptide is still relatively stable, but it's not as stable as it is at lower temperatures. Over time, there might be a slow degradation process. However, if you're using the nosiheptide within a few months, the degradation won't be significant enough to affect its performance. So, if you're a small - scale user and you're going to use up the product in a short time, storing it at room temperature is perfectly fine.

Now, things get a bit more complicated when we talk about higher temperatures. When the temperature rises above 30°C, the stability of nosiheptide starts to decline more rapidly. The increased thermal energy causes the nosiheptide molecules to vibrate more vigorously, which can break the chemical bonds within the molecule. This leads to the formation of degradation products, which might not have the same beneficial effects as the original nosiheptide.

For example, if you leave nosiheptide in a hot warehouse during the summer months, where the temperature can easily reach 40°C or even higher, the degradation rate will be quite high. You might notice a decrease in its potency after just a few weeks. This is why it's crucial to store nosiheptide in a cool and dry place, especially in regions with hot climates.

It's also important to note that humidity can play a role in nosiheptide's stability at different temperatures. High humidity can accelerate the degradation process, especially at higher temperatures. Moisture can react with nosiheptide and promote chemical reactions that break down the molecule. So, even if the temperature is not extremely high, high humidity can still pose a problem.

So, how can you ensure the stability of nosiheptide in your storage? First, invest in proper storage facilities. If possible, use a temperature - controlled storage room or a refrigerator. Make sure the storage area is dry and well - ventilated. Also, keep the nosiheptide in its original packaging, as it's designed to protect the product from environmental factors.

When it comes to transportation, it's also important to consider temperature. If you're shipping nosiheptide over long distances, especially in hot weather, use insulated containers or refrigerated trucks to maintain a stable temperature.
